Claims (5)
1. Anordning för bläsning av gas samt eventuellt finfördelat fastmaterial inne i en metallurgisk smälta, vilken anordning om-fattar ett bläsrör (1) med en inloppsöppning vid den ena ändan, vilken öppning är avsedd att anslutas tili en gaskälla och en ut-loppsöppning vid den motsatta ändan, avsedd att sänkas under smäl-tans yta för att bläsa gas inne i smältan, en blasröret omgivande kylningsanordning, som har vid den mot inloppsöppningen vända ändan en inlopps- (4) och utloppsöppning (6) för kyIningsmedlet, samt en mantel (7) av värmeisolerande keramiskt material, omgivande ätminstone den nedre delen av kylningsanordningen, kanne-t e c k n a d av att det förefinns vid bläsrörets utloppsöppning ett Laval-munstycke (9), som bildar en vinkel med blasröret och som sträcker sig genom den värmeisolerande mäntein (7), att kylningsanordningen bildas av kylningsrör (4, 6), med en liten diameter och väsentligen parallella med blasröret (1) och vilkas inloppsöppning är avsedd att anslutas tili en sadan källa av gas-vätskeblandning, som snabbt förängas i kylningsanordningen och mäntein (7) omgivits med en holk (8) av grafit eller kiselkarbid, vilken holk är ätminstone av sadan tjocklek, att den skyddar det keramiska materialet (7), när anordningen sänks inne i smältan sä, att det keramiska materialet ernär smältans temperatur Läng-sammare än holken och sintras innan holken slitats.
2. Anordning enligt patentkravet 1, kännetecknad av att gasbläsröret ställts i en sadan ställning i den metallur-giska smältan, att reaktionsmedlet avlägsnas frän gasbläsröret horisontellt i förhällande tili reaktionsmedelröret (1).
3. Anordning enligt patentkravet 1 eller 2, kännetecknad av att Laval-munstycket (9) av gasbläsröret är av sintrad metallblandning, som innehäller utöver krom 2-5 vikt-% koboit.
